For years, lactic acid got the blame.
But the science tells a very different story.
What Is Lactate?
When you're running comfortably, your muscles mainly use oxygen to produce energy.
As you speed up or tackle a steep hill, your muscles need energy much faster.
Your body switches to a quicker energy system, producing lactate.
Despite its reputation, lactate isn't a waste product.
It's actually another fuel.
Your heart can use it.
Your brain can use it.
Even your other muscles can use it.
Think of lactate as an emergency power bank that appears when your muscles need energy quickly.
So Why Do My Legs Burn?
That burning feeling isn't because lactate is "poisoning" your muscles.
It's caused by the rapid changes occurring inside the muscle when you're exercising at a very high intensity.
Your muscles are working incredibly hard.
The burn is simply a sign that they're close to their limit.
What About Muscle Soreness?
Carlos expected to wake up the next morning unable to move.
Sure enough, his calves were tight.
His quads ached.
Walking downstairs became an Olympic event.
Surely that was lactic acid?
Actually…no.
Most lactate is cleared from your bloodstream within about an hour after finishing exercise.
By the next morning, it's long gone.
What Carlos was experiencing was Delayed Onset Muscle Soreness (DOMS).
DOMS is thought to result mainly from tiny amounts of muscle damage caused by unfamiliar or strenuous exercise. As your body repairs those muscles, soreness develops—often peaking 24 to 72 hours after exercise.
Can Nutrition Reduce Muscle Soreness?
Good nutrition won't stop DOMS completely, but it can help your body recover more effectively.
Focus on:
Carbohydrates
Replace the glycogen you used during your run.
Good options include:
-
Rice
-
Pasta
-
Potatoes
-
Fruit
-
Wholegrain bread
Protein
Aim for around 20–30 grams of high-quality protein soon after your run.
Examples include:
-
Greek yoghurt
-
Milk
-
Eggs
-
Chicken
-
Fish
-
Tofu
Hydration
Replace the fluids you've lost through sweat.
For longer or hotter runs, include electrolytes as well.
Eat Enough
One of the biggest recovery mistakes runners make is under-fuelling.
Your body can't repair muscles properly if it doesn't have enough energy.
